Physical and Mechanical Properties of Heat-Treated Five Hardwood Species
Heat treated was performed at 185℃ on five hardwood species(Schima superha, Dryobalanops keithii, Fraxinus mandshurica,Betula platyphylla and Couratari oblongifolia). Dimensional stability and modulus of elasticity (MOE) before and after treatment indicated significant increase. The equilibrium moisture content (EMC) decreased by 26.65%, radial swelling value by 19.72%, tangential swelling value by 26.38%.
